Ok, so you are in the syndicate that has just won the euro millions, you are sharing the pot of 45 mill (lucky buggers) the only thing is, one of your group pulled out at the very last moment so has lost out..

what would you do?

Personally i know i would have to share mine and i would hope that my companions would feel the same.. if this poor sod has always been in it but dropped out just once, then i think i wouldn't be able to do anything else..

If I hasd just been given wealth beyond my wildest dreams, then there is no way i would want to do any thing else but.

I am very curious to know tho what you all would do...

I think it would depend on the reason they had dropped out, if it was for genuine reasons then maybe i would be sympathetic, i don't think it would be fair to ask everyone to split the winnings equally so they would have got the same amount but maybe give him or her an amount to make them happy, if however they had dropped out becauce they were regular bad payers or were just tight then i would say tough look, we have syndicates at work am in far too many personally but there are people who moan and are a pain in the backside to get money of, in there case i would say tough, its only fair on those that pay up week in week out.And i can tell you now if a group of people had won that amount of money and this predicament arose there would be a majority who would not give the person involved a bean, i'm afraid money changes people, sad but true and not for the right reasons.
